WebApr 14, 2024 · Oyster shell is used as a calcium supplement for chickens. Oysters are mollusks, and their shells are made of calcium carbonate and protein. Calcium is essential to a chicken’s diet to ensure hard, well-formed eggshells. One of the most reliable and popular methods of ensuring your girls get the proper amount of calcium is through oyster shells. WebFeb 28, 2024 · Grit: To help digest their food, chickens need to eat grit like sand or coarse dirt. The grit will help the gizzard grind up the food, making it easier to digest and to pull nutrients from.
